A collection of short talks on psychiatry, technology, and conversation - organized by high school students! In the spirit of ideas worth spreading, TED has created a program called TEDx. These local, self-organized events are branded TEDx, where x = independently organized TED event. At TEDxBrownellTalbotSchool, prerecorded TED talks and live speakers combine to spark deep discussion and connection in a small group.   • Carrie Rise

    Teacher, Brownell-Talbot

    Mrs. Rise has taught at Brownell-Talbot for all 26 years of her career. When she started at BT, she wanted to make a difference with students that had a desire to learn and were excited about school. In her classroom, she holds high the ability to solve problems. Some of her fondest memories are of students who worked harder than they thought they could and in the end found the solution they were looking for. Most recently, Mrs. Rise has helped institute the use of 3D printing technology in the classroom.

  • Cynthia Paul

    Forensic Psychiatrist, Heartland Family Services

    Cynthia Paul is a forensic psychiatrist who practices in the Omaha area. She currently practices with Heartland Family services, and is one of very few practicing forensic psychiatrists in the state of Nebraska. Her job description includes the delicate task of assessing whether accused criminals are in a mental state to stand trial.
